Output 16944e9236ee120141f73d1a311d1cf546b0a338030244e8c6cfe84d001d5cba:0

value
2884666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f069baa078c2fee26ef24bdf4fc011e284d7a99 OP_EQUALVERIFY OP_CHECKSIG
address
1JR3yn16TskijrhdeScG3mMn2WAb4RwXzq
transaction
16944e9236ee120141f73d1a311d1cf546b0a338030244e8c6cfe84d001d5cba
spent
true